Some newbie questions here, what can i use for my cherokee??
i just bought my firs cherokee 2 days ago, i needa do some repairs to it, so i got a couple questions. i have a 1996 Country Edition 4.0 litre. what years are my parts interchangable with? I need some doors so what years can i look at to change them with? and what different models? can i only use stuff from other country editions or can i use stuff from laredos or limiteds?

Hi and welcome to CF asked almost the same question a few weeks ago and a member called 5-90 responded with this
Body parts? 1984-1996 are direct swap. 1997-2001 front sheetmetal can be made to fit with some mild modification (it's been done for aesthetic reasons, although I don't care for it,) and the liftgates do not swap on either side of the 1996/1997 break.
Engine parts run a little closer - 1987-1990 will swap directly, 1991-1995 will swap among themselves, 1996-1999, and 2000-2001 will all swap around directly within brackets.
You can swap across brackets with engine parts, but it often takes a small bit of work to make things happen properly (for instance, swapping a 1991-1995 cylinder head onto 1996-up requires an adapter plate to make the exhaust ports line up, or use the earlier exhaust manifold as well. The 1996-up main bearing cap brace can be swapped onto any year of 242ci engine by bringing the studs and nuts along with - but don't transplant the caps unless you plan on having them machined to fit the new block. Things like that.)
